Subject: Lease Renegotiation — Hartwell Quay

Executive team: negotiations with the landlord of the Hartwell Quay site concluded Friday. Terms: seven-year renewal, 12% rent reduction, landlord funds the floor-three refit. Annual savings approximately 410K. Legal review closes Wednesday; signature targeted for month end. Exit clause at year four secured. Board ratification requested at Thursday's session. The related plan for the Marden site is noted below.

confidential, kagup-bafog: Fraaxax Group is in early talks to buy Soroxox Group for about $343.8 million. The Olidor launch date is June 14, and nothing goes to the press before then. Legal wants the Aldmirek Logistics term sheet signed before July 23.

Heads up, on-call: the Gristmill GPU memory profiler is drifting again between prod and the canary pool. The canary boxes picked up the new sampling interval from last week's rollout, but prod is still running the old allocator-trace settings, so the dashboards disagree and the alert thresholds are basically fiction right now. Quickest fix is to re-apply the intended config and restart the profiler daemon on the prod pool. For reference, the values prod *should* be running are below.

service settings:
PRAIX_LOG_LEVEL=error
PRAIX_METRICS_HOST=metrics.praix.qorvelcorp.corp
PRAIX_POOL_SIZE=16

Ticket #— Floor 9 Opening Prep, Brindlemoor House

Hi facilities folks, Floor 9 opens to staff next Monday and we need a few things squared away before then. Lift access is live, but the two side doors by the kitchenette are still on the old lock config — please reprogram them before Friday. Also, signage for the quiet rooms hasn't arrived, so pop up the temporary printed ones for now. Until the badge readers sync, the interim door code for Floor 9 is below.

door code, bajop-bajog: bdg-DSWAC-43621

Bounce processor handover, for the sync. Mailtrawl now classifies hard vs. soft bounces itself; the old regex fallback is removed. Suppression list syncs hourly. Known issue: soft bounces from the Bramwick relay occasionally double-count — dedupe fix is in review. Alerts fire above 5% bounce rate per campaign. Queue draining steps and metrics dashboards are documented on the internal page.

operations page: https://jenkins.zemvarcloud.local/job/merge_requests/repo/build/73930b4b30f0a8ed